A Recorder is responsible for accurately documenting and maintaining official records, such as legal documents, meeting minutes, or public records. They ensure records are properly stored, updated, and accessible as needed. Depending on the industry, a Recorder may work in government offices, courts, or businesses that require meticulous record-keeping. Strong attention to detail and organization skills are essential for this role.
A Recorder is primarily responsible for accurately documenting and maintaining official records, such as meeting minutes, legal documents, or public filings, depending on the organization. This often involves preparing, reviewing, and storing documents, as well as responding to records requests from staff or external parties. Recorders may collaborate closely with legal teams, government officials, or administrative staff to ensure compliance with regulations and timely access to critical information. While much of the work is administrative, attention to confidentiality and precision is essential, making the role both important and rewarding for those who excel in detail-oriented tasks.
To thrive as a Recorder, you need strong attention to detail, excellent organizational skills, and a solid understanding of legal terminology or public record management, often supported by relevant certifications or prior administrative experience. Familiarity with document management systems, audio-recording technology, or specialized transcription software is often required. Strong interpersonal, time management, and written communication skills help Recoders collaborate effectively and handle sensitive information with discretion. These combined skills are vital to ensure that records are maintained accurately, efficiently, and in compliance with legal or organizational standards.

The State of Alaska (SOA) uses four proficiency levels to measure and describe an applicant's competence in applying specific behaviors, knowledge, skills, and abilities to accomplish a specific task. The four proficiency levels are Mastery, Fluency, Literacy, and Discovery. You must rate your proficiency level for each competency listed in the supplemental questions.
